After removal of the foley catheter, interventions should be employed to encourage spontaneous voiding: Early mobilization Offering toileting with use of toilet or bedside commode to allow for upright position Privacy 2. The patient will be assessed by the RN for the following parameters: Patient is spontaneously voiding without difficulty WebPatient is spontaneously voiding without difficulty Patient is not voiding, however, is comfortable and expresses no desire to void 3. A bladder scan should be done for any of the following: Patient is uncomfortable at any time, whether voiding or not Patient has an urge to void but is unable to do so Patient is incontinent at any time settlers boarding school in limpopo
